The last day of your life is the fourth solo album by the rapper Farid Bang . It was released on January 27, 2012 via Eko Freshs label German Dream in cooperation with the Sony subsidiary 7days music entertainment AG as a standard, iTunes and Amazon edition (including T-shirt and DVD ).

content

As on previous releases by the artist, there are many typical gangsta rap songs on the album . These include Farid Bang , The Last Day of Your Life , Pusher , I Want Beef and Samurai . There are swipes against other rappers like Sido and Alpa Gun . In contrast to these pieces, there are also several thoughtful, quieter songs (e.g. Alemania , No Tear , Irgendwann , I miss you ) on the sound carrier.

Guest Posts

Contributions by other artists can be found on only six songs on the album. Farid Bang's label colleague Summer Cem can be heard in the song Vom Dealer zum Rapstar , while the American rapper Young Buck has a guest article on Converse Musik . The singer Ramsi Aliani appears at some point and the singer Zemine sings the chorus with I miss you . Farid Bangs label boss Eko Fresh also raps on the track German Dream 2012 and the rapper L-Nino is represented on the bonus song Weißer Krieger . In addition, Summer Cem, Eko Fresh, Massiv , Kollegah , Bass Sultan Hengzt and Favorite are represented at the intro . On the iTunes version, the song Converse Musik (Remix) features guest contributions by Al-Gear , L-Nino, Massiv , as well as by Young Buck, who is already featured on the standard version of the song.

Cover design

The covers of both editions are in comic format. For example, the cover of the standard edition shows a muscular figure with a bare upper body, which resembles Farid Bang and strikes out to strike. The artwork of the Amazon edition shows the same figure with two firearms in his hands. In the upper part of the illustrations are the words Farid Bang and The last day of your life .

Before the publication of these two album covers, a comic-like artwork made its way onto the Internet, showing the artists Sido , Kool Savas , Alpa Gun and DJ Desue in the crosshairs alongside Farid Bang . However, this illustration was allegedly discarded due to an injunction.

marketing

In the run-up to the album's release, videos for the songs Keine Träne , Alemania , Irgendwann and Pusher as well as a nine-part video blog appeared on the Internet. A snippet was also published on January 18, 2012.

The last day of your life entered the German album charts at number 3 in the 7th calendar week of 2012. Until the release of the album Jung, brutal, gutaussehend 2 , which reached number 1 on the album charts in mid-February 2013 , number 3 for The Last Day of Your Life was the highest chart position for both Farid Bang and his label German Dream . The album stayed in the top 100 for four weeks. According to Farid Bang, he sold around 50,000 copies of the album, including over 20,000 in the first week of sales alone.

As the only single for the album, the song Sometime was released for download on February 10, 2012 , but could not be placed in the charts.
